Google Nexus 6 (64GB) vs Nokia 7 Plus
Here you can compare Google Nexus 6 (64GB) and Nokia 7 Plus. Comparing Google Nexus 6 (64GB) vs Nokia 7 Plus on Smartprix enables you to check their respective specs scores and unique features. It would potentially help you understand how Google Nexus 6 (64GB) stands against Nokia 7 Plus and which one should you buy The current lowest price found for Google Nexus 6 (64GB) is ₹21,999 and for Nokia 7 Plus is ₹9,994. The details of both of these products were last updated on Apr 25, 2024.
Specification | Google Nexus 6 (64GB) | Nokia 7 Plus |
---|---|---|
Rear Camera | 13 MP | 12 MP + 13 MP with autofocus |
Battery | 3220 mAh | 3800 mAh, Li-ion Battery |
Internal Memory | 64 GB | 64 GB |
OS | Android v5 (Lollipop) | Android v8.0 (Oreo) |
Display | 6 inches, 2560 x 1440 pixels | 6 inches, 1080 x 2160 pixels |
Price | ₹21,999 | ₹9,994 |
